SALT LAKE CITY — Utah's special Republican primary election for the 2nd Congressional District U.S. House seat got top billing Tuesday night, but dozens of city council elections and one mayoral race were narrowed down as well.

The Ogden mayoral primary remained close throughout Tuesday and Wednesday, but Taylor Knuth and Ben Nadolski ultimately advanced to the general election, with Knuth getting 168 votes more than Nadolski.

Knuth finished with 1,997 overall votes to 1,829 for Nadolski. Third-place finisher Bart Blair wasn't far behind at 1,770 votes, trailing Nadolski by just 59 votes with nearly all votes totaled.

"Ogden is the city that built me. It's the city where I became a first-generation college graduate and first-generation homeowner, the city where I built my career and started my family, and most importantly, it's the city that truly set me on a path that I was never meant to be on," Knuth said. "Growing up with a single mother who worked multiple jobs to make ends meet, I was never meant to run for office, let alone win a primary election to be Ogden's next mayor. And yet, the people of Ogden have made their choice clear."

Three-term Mayor Mike Caldwell did not seek reelection, paving the path for a close race to replace him.

The general election is Nov. 21.

The race for Salt Lake City mayor wasn't on the ballot Tuesday because the city opted for ranked-choice voting in lieu of a primary.
